Power Management
This function is to allow the radio to go to Standby if there
is no internet signal received in order to save power. The
default setting is 30 minutes. When the radio does not
receive any internet signal, the radio will go into Standby
after 30 minutes. Other time frame for 5 minutes and 15
minutes are available. You can choose to turn it off too.
Sleep Timer
You can set the timer to put the radio in standby after
certain time elapsed, from 15 minutes to 180 minutes with
the step of every 15 minute.

Internet Radio
Buffer
Sometimes you may experience uneven playback of the
internet radio. This can happen if the internet connection
is slow or network congestion occurs. To help improving
the situation, you can choose longer buffer time to get a
few seconds of radio stream before beginning to play.
The default value is 2 seconds. You can choose 4 or 8
seconds if you prefer to have a longer buffering time.
Sound quality: Choose the level at High or Low.
